Logo
TaskRabbit

Senior Software Engineer, Partnerships

TaskRabbit, California, Missouri, United States, 65018


This role will be fully remote through August 2025 with the expectation that employees will begin working 2 days per week in our dedicated office space starting September 2025.

About the Job:At a point of major inflection and scale, Taskrabbit is looking for a Senior Software Engineer to help design and implement our Partner API platform that enables Taskrabbit to integrate with other businesses so they can offer Taskrabbit services to their customers. Partnerships are a critical growth engine for Taskrabbit and one of our top strategic priorities. Taskrabbit is integrated with IKEA, our parent company, and we are building our partnerships platform to unlock more business opportunities through new partnerships. We seek a strong technical leader with experience building a robust and scalable platform to support current and future partners at scale. This Senior Software Engineer will be responsible for collaborating with peers in Engineering, Architecture, Data, Product, and other business leaders to build a partnerships platform to support and sustain hyper-growth for Taskrabbit.

Join us in transforming lives one task at a time

You will be:

Designing, building, and maintaining partner-facing solutions which follow our engineering principles:

expose the ability to be measured and observed

protect our customer, our business, and our partners and their data

always do what the customer expects and upon failure, data is recoverable

always available when and where the customer expects and which are healthy and current

perform to, and exceed, customer expectations

delight the customer

Contributing to the growth and success of team members through code review, clear documentation, and mentorship

Contributing to initiatives across the company to support the Partnerships program.

Accelerating the Partner integration experience through developer tooling, SDKs, and documentation

Working collaboratively to establish best practices, refine project requirements, and unblock yourself and others

You should have:

6+ years of experience in software engineering, partner engineering, or similar roles

Experience building developer platforms, helping define the strategy, and being collaborative with cross-functional teams

Experience designing and building API endpoints.

Strong design and architecture skills.

Experience with software engineering best practices (e.g., unit testing, code reviews, technical design documentation).

Proficiency with Ruby/Rails

Experience with MySQL, Redis, ElasticSearch, and similar technologies.

You might be a fit if you have:

Strong written and verbal communication skills.

Desire to work with a layered application architecture.

Enjoy owning and scoping high-visibility projects to keep us moving forward.

Great attention to detail and quality.

Love collaborating with a tight-knit team and across the organization.

Bonus Points:

Care deeply and are opinionated about partnership programs, API design patterns, or the developer experience

Built a customer-facing API integration

Compensation & Benefits:At Taskrabbit, our approach to compensation is designed to be competitive, transparent and equitable. total compensation consists of base pay + bonus + benefits + perks.

The base pay range for this position is $115,000. - $160,000 This range is representative of base pay only, and does not include any other total cash compensation amounts, such as company bonus or benefits. Final offer amounts may vary from the amounts listed above, and will be determined by factors including, but not limited to, relevant experience, qualifications, geography, and level.

#J-18808-Ljbffr